Here in the Last Frontier, while our state association has not made any ruling to NOT accept the NFHS change, I know that the fields the high schools play on here in Anchorage are city parks fields assigned to the local ASA association. The local ASA group (www.anchoragesports.com) is also the organization that schedules local high school games ran under NFHS rules here since Anchorage decided to "orphan" Softball and Baseball a number of years ago during a budget squabble. This basically means that the school district endorses the sports but does not sponser them. Translation: no school district money goes to the Softball and Baseball programs.

OK... I wandered off.. but the end result is that in Anchorage, the local association (Anchorage Sports) does not allow cleats on their fields. I don't know what other parts of the state are doing. Our state tournament is in Anchorage at a complex that include artifical turf infields on some fields, and is operated by the group that does not allow metal spikes on their fields so I doubt they will be allowed at State.
